Some acid `NH_(4)HS` is placed in flask containing `0.5 atm` of `NH_(3)`. What would be pressures of `NH_(3)` and `H_(2)S` when equilibrium is reached?
`NH_(4)HS_((s))hArrNH_(3(g))+H_(2)S_((g))`, `K_(p)=0.11`

A

`6.65` atm

B

`0.665` atm

C

`0.0665` atm

D

`66.5` atm

Text Solution

Verified by Experts

The correct Answer is:
B

`NH_(4)HShArrNH_(3)+H_(2)S`
`0.5+x x`
`(0.5+x)=0.11`
